Özet
Carbon taxation has become prominent as an effective policy tool in combating global climate change in today's world. This study aims to investigate the impact of carbon pricing on carbon emissions and carbon footprint (CF), focusing on the Nordic countries, which were the first to implement carbon taxation, using panel data analysis method between 1992 and 2021. The econometric tests applied in the study are as follows, in order: cross-section dependence tests, Delta homogeneity tests, second-generation panel unit root tests, Gegenbach et al.(2016) panel cointegration test, panel Dynamic Ordinary Least Squares Mean Group (DOLSMG) estimator, and Dumitrescu and Hurlin (2012) panel causality test. According to the findings of the coefficient estimation results, we determine that carbon pricing is effective in reducing carbon emissions and CF. In addition to the findings indicating cointegration among the variables, we also obtain evidence of a unidirectional causal relationship from carbon pricing to carbon emissions and CF.
